The Corporate Controller will play a pivotal role in directing FalconX's global accounting activities. This position requires a dynamic leader who can inspire a high-performing accounting team while embracing the complexities of a rapidly evolving industry. The ideal candidate will possess a deep understanding of US GAAP principles, Sarbanes-Oxley (SOX) compliance, and financial operations. You will be instrumental in building a world-class accounting function and ensuring our systems and processes operate smoothly across the business.

Responsibilities

  • Lead and develop the global accounting team, driving efficiency and automation to meet the demands of our high-growth environment.
  • Oversee the monthly global financial close process, ensuring accurate and timely preparation of global consolidation.
  • Own the general ledger and recording of all business transactions, including detailed analysis and reconciliation of accounts, while ensuring compliance with US GAAP, local accounting requirements, and internal policies.
  • Enhance operational effectiveness and efficiency within the Controllership organization by streamlining and improving processes and internal controls.
  • Manage annual external audit preparation and oversight, liaising with finance transformation, tax, treasury, legal, and other functions.
  • Build and lead a strong global team through active recruiting, motivating, coaching, training, and mentoring team members.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to support strategic initiatives and provide financial insights.
  • Engage in ad-hoc projects as needed to support the organization's growth and strategic objectives.

Required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in accounting, finance, or a related field; Active CPA or equivalent certification required.
  • 10+ years of progressive accounting experience, including roles as a Controller or Director of Accounting in the financial services, fintech, or payments industry, with a minimum of 7+ years in senior management leading large global teams.
  • Strong knowledge and leadership in accounting operations, with proven experience in building, developing, mentoring, and inspiring a diverse, high-performing professional accounting team globally.
  •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al, with the ability to convey complex concepts and risk factors to stakeholders and influence decision-making.
  • Experienced business partner skilled in building trust and inspiring others in a complex environment.
  • Proven track record in assessing, developing, and implementing internal controls while maintaining efficient processes.
  • Excitement about navigating a hyper-growth, rapidly changing, and sometimes ambiguous environment.

The base pay for this role is expected to be between $230,000 - $311,000 for a Director level and $272,000 - $368,000 for a Senior Director level in the New York City and San Francisco Bay Area. Please note that for a remote employee, compensation bands will be lower for locations outside of these areas. This expected base pay range is based on information at the time this post was generated. This role will also be eligible for other forms of compensation such as a performance linked bonus, equity, and a competitive benefits package. Actual compensation for a successful candidate will be determined based on a number of factors such as location, skillset, experience, qualifications and the level at which the candidate is hired.

FalconX embarked on its journey in 2018, born from a vision to revolutionize institutional access to the burgeoning digital asset markets. Founded by Raghu Yarlagadda and Prabhakar Reddy, the company recognized the inherent complexities and fragmentation that hindered sophisticated investors from fully participating in the crypto space. What began as an idea to bridge the gap between traditional finance and the world of digital currencies quickly materialized into a robust platform designed to meet the nuanced needs of institutional clients. The early days were characterized by intensive development, focusing on building a technology stack capable of providing reliable, efficient, and secure access to global crypto liquidity. The team, a blend of experts from leading financial institutions, trading firms, and technology giants, understood that to gain the trust of institutions, they needed to offer more than just access; they needed to provide a comprehensive suite of services akin to those found in traditional prime brokerages.

As FalconX evolved, its commitment to this vision deepened. The platform expanded its offerings to include not only trading execution but also credit, financing, and clearing services, all accessible through a single, intuitive interface. This holistic approach resonated with hedge funds, proprietary trading firms, asset managers, and other institutional players who were seeking a reliable and sophisticated partner in the digital asset realm. The company's dedication to leveraging data science and machine learning allowed it to offer superior execution by smart routing trades across numerous liquidity sources, minimizing slippage and hidden fees. This technological prowess, combined with a relentless focus on regulatory compliance and client service, propelled FalconX's growth. It secured significant funding from prominent investors, enabling further expansion of its global footprint, with offices established in key financial hubs including Silicon Valley, New York, London, Singapore, and Hong Kong. Today, FalconX stands as a leading digital asset prime brokerage, processing trillions in trading volume and serving hundreds of institutions worldwide, continually innovating to deliver the financial platform of tomorrow.
